android - 在 Android 上以编程方式对已安装应用程序列表进行分类

标签 android application-settings

<分区>

我有一个函数可以获取用户手机上所有已安装应用程序的列表。无论如何我可以根据安装的应用程序的类别对这个列表进行排序吗? 示例 - Messenger、Whatsapp、Facebook Messenger} 实现这一目标的最佳方法是什么?

最佳答案

应用程序信息可能包含如下内容:

包名, 应用名称, 权限, 图标和图像。

因此,我们无法获取该应用的 google playstore 数据。 Google Playstore 有类别和其他无法以编程方式获取的类别。

你可以尝试这个 sdk 但它的非官方 API http://code.google.com/p/android-market-api/

引用:https://stackoverflow.com/a/6175782/4609016

关于android - 在 Android 上以编程方式对已安装应用程序列表进行分类,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/36735104/

相关文章:

node.js - app.set() 可以设置哪些设置?

Android 操作栏向上导航按钮在设备上不起作用

android - RunBlocking 与 Dispatcher 通信不起作用

Android 首选项从数据库中添加值

android - 如何从 firebase 更快地检索数据

ios - 为什么 Apple 使用不同的文件夹结构来进行 bundle 和字符串本地化?

c# - 如何使应用程序设置独立于 .exe 路径?

android - 电晕与 Xamarin?我应该拿起什么?

c# - 如何修复错误 : "Could not find schema information for the attribute/element" by creating schema

ios - 从另一个应用程序打开设置应用程序